I liked this one:
There used to be so many
Of my fingerprints to see,
On furniture and walls and things
From sticky, grubby me
But if you stop and think a while
You'll see I'm growing fast
Those little handprints disappear
You can't bring back what's passed.
So here's a small reminder
To keep, not wipe away,
Of tiny hands and how they looked
To make you smile someday.
